The Microchip ATMEGA162 CMOS 8-bit microcontroller is based on the AVR enhanced RISC architecture. It features 16K bytes of In-System programmable flash with read while-write capabilities, 512 bytes EEPROM, 1K bytes SRAM, an external memory interface, 35 general purpose I/O lines, 32 general purpose working registers, a JTAG interface for Boundary-scan, On-chip debugging support and programming, four flexible Timer/Counters with compare modes, internal and external interrupts, two serial programmable USARTs, a programmable watchdog timer with internal oscillator, an SPI serial port, and five software selectable power saving modes. The Idle mode stops the CPU while allowing the SRAM, Timer/Counters, SPI port, and interrupt system to continue functioning. The Power-down mode saves the register contents but freezes the oscillator, disabling all other chip functions until the next interrupt or Hardware Reset. In Power-save mode, the asynchronous timer continues to run, allowing the user to maintain a timer base while the rest of the device is sleeping. In standby mode, the crystal/resonator oscillator is running while the rest of the device is sleeping.

Up to 16 MIPS throughput at 16 MHz

Programming lock for software security

On-chip analog comparator

Power-on reset and programmable brown-out detection

Two 8-bit Timer/Counters with separate prescalers and compare modes

Two 16-bit Timer/Counters with separate prescalers, compare modes, and capture modes

Internal calibrated RC oscillator

External and internal interrupt sources
